Understanding Computer Vision: A Brief Overview
Computer vision is a branch of artificial intelligence that focuses on enabling computers to understand and process visual data from the world around them. It involves a combination of hardware and software solutions designed to capture, process, and analyze images and videos. Over the years, computer vision has evolved significantly, thanks to advancements in areas like image processing, object recognition, and deep learning.
At its core, computer vision relies on several key components. Image processing involves manipulating digital images to enhance their quality or extract useful information. Object recognition, on the other hand, is the process of identifying and classifying objects within images or videos. Deep learning, particularly through neural networks, has been pivotal in advancing object recognition capabilities, allowing machines to learn from vast datasets and improve accuracy over time.
The evolution of computer vision has been marked by significant milestones. Early efforts focused on basic tasks like edge detection and feature extraction. However, with the advent of powerful computational resources and large-scale datasets, modern computer vision systems can now perform complex tasks such as facial recognition, scene understanding, and even autonomous driving.
Creative Applications of Computer Vision in the Arts
The integration of computer vision in the arts has led to groundbreaking innovations, offering artists new tools and mediums for creative expression. From digital art creation to interactive installations, computer vision is being used in myriad ways to push the boundaries of traditional art forms.
One notable example is the use of computer vision in digital art creation. Artists like Memo Akten and Refik Anadol have employed machine learning algorithms to generate visually stunning works that respond to human input in real-time. Akten’s project “Learning to See” uses deep neural networks trained on vast collections of images to produce abstract visualizations that reflect the complexity of human perception.
Interactive installations are another area where computer vision plays a crucial role. For instance, the “Deep Dream Generator” by Google allows users to upload images and apply neural network algorithms to transform them into surreal, dreamlike compositions. These installations often involve cameras and sensors that track viewer movements, creating immersive experiences that react dynamically to audience interactions.
Generative art, which involves the use of algorithms to create art autonomously, is also gaining traction. Projects like “GANbreeder” by Robbie Barrat utilize generative adversarial networks (GANs) to produce unique pieces of artwork. These GANs are trained on datasets of existing artworks and can generate new pieces that blend styles and techniques in unexpected ways.
Challenges and Ethical Considerations
While the integration of computer vision in the arts offers exciting opportunities, it also raises important challenges and ethical considerations. Privacy concerns are paramount when dealing with technologies that rely on capturing and analyzing visual data. Artists must ensure that their use of computer vision respects individuals’ privacy and does not infringe upon their rights.
Bias in algorithms is another issue that needs careful attention. Machine learning models can inadvertently perpetuate stereotypes or discrimination if they are trained on biased datasets. Artists working with computer vision should strive to create inclusive and equitable works that challenge rather than reinforce harmful biases.
Furthermore, there is a risk of misuse of technology. As computer vision becomes more sophisticated, there is a potential for it to be exploited for malicious purposes. Artists play a crucial role in shaping the future of computer vision by pushing boundaries and exploring new possibilities responsibly. By raising awareness about these issues and advocating for ethical practices, artists can help ensure that computer vision technologies are used for positive and creative ends.
